BUAD 2001
Introduction to Applied Artificial Intelligence
Marquette University · UGRD · Fall 2026
Catalog description
Couched in an ethical and responsible use perspective; introduces students to Applied Artificial Intelligence-related technologies and skills applicable at a fundamental level to any career in business. By the end of the course, students are expected to be able to develop and use critical technologies at an introductory level to be empowered to contribute to solutions for industry-related problems, and to understand the ethical and governance implications. Throughout the course, students describe and explain the significant technologies driving innovation in business and how to use them responsibly, learn how to utilize key programming languages and software to enable the student to meaningfully contribute to advancing a company’s technological capabilities, use critical thinking skills applied to technologies to solve and debug problems, and communicate and present using correct business terminology efficiently and understandably.
